Mouawad Roots to Bad Beat Olofsson

Level 10 : Blinds 600/1,200, 1,200 ante

Attila Zab opened to 3,000 from the hijack, Joseph Mouawad three-bet to 13,500 from the cutoff and Stefan Olofsson moved all in for 45,000 from the button. Zab folded and Mouawad went into the tank.

"Aces again?" he asked before finally making the call.

Stefan Olofsson: AK
Joseph Mouawad: AK

What was overwhelmingly likely to be a chopped pot soon went astray as the first four cards came 5QJ6. With three spades on board, Mouawad now had an ace-high flush draw. "Just one more!" Mouawad politely asked. But the river landed the 9 and both players seemed happy enough to chop the pot.

Giuliano Wins Coin Flip

Level 11 : Blinds 1,000/1,500, 1,500 ante

Silvio Giuliano raised to 3,000 from middle position before Stefan Burch made it 8,000 to go from the cutoff. Nicola Grieco smooth-called from the small blind and Giuliano shoved all in for 63,000 once the action was back on him.

Burch quickly got out of the way but Grieco made the call with the covering stack.

Silvio Giuliano: A9
Nicola Grieco: 44

"A coin flip," stated Grieco while tabling their cards.

It was indeed a flip, and one he would lose when Giuliano made the superior hand on the 91038K runout. Giuliano doubled up while Grieco still had more than 40 bigs to play with.

Boika Leaves Wasek with Fumes, Busts Shortly After

Level 11 : Blinds 1,000/1,500, 1,500 ante
Aliaksei Boika
Aliaksei Boika

Aliaksei Boika opened to 3,000 from middle position, receiving a call from Artur Wasek, on the button.

Boika continued for 3,500 on the 98K flop. Wasek chose to see a turn.

The J fell and Boika bet out again, this time for 7,000. Wasek was undettered.

The river landed the 10 and Boika bet 35,000; an effective all-in with just 500 behind. Wasek snap-called. Boika tabled A7 for the nut flush, while Wasek folded the Q face up.

Wasek could be seen leaving the tournament floor shortly afterwards.

Tamasauskas Wins Flip to Double Stack

Level 11 : Blinds 1,000/1,500, 1,500 ante

Vincas Tamasauskas was all in preflop against Patrik Zidek, who had him covered as players flipped their cards.

Vincas Tamasauskas: 99
Patrik Zidek: AQ

The board ran out 58546. Zidek picked up a flush draw on the flop along with his overcards. He blanked the turn and river though, leaving Tamasauskas to scoop the pot with two pair, his pocket nines and the fives on board.
